1.6.7 Setting parameters for WAN network nodes
You set parameters for SINAUT WAN networks in the
Properties - SINAUT Dedicated Line
or in the
Properties - SINAUT Dial-up Network
dialog in the following tabs:
●
General
tab with general information on the network node and entry of comments
●
Network Connection
tab for setting the most important network properties
●
Basic Param.
tab for setting the basic communication parameters
●
Dedicated Line
tab with parameters specifically for dedicated lines
●
Dial-up Network
tab with parameters specifically for dial-up networks
●
Call Parameters
tab with parameters specifically for call numbers
●
AT Initialization
tab for setting special AT strings when they are required
The relevant tabs are displayed depending on the network type.
Note
When setting parameters for network nodes, only the parameters that are practicable for the
particular combination can be modified. This depends on the following:
• Network node type specified in the
Properties Network Node
dialog,
Network Connection
tab
and the
• Operating mode specified in the
Properties Network
dialog,
Network Settings
tab.
